Soil extracellular enzymatic catalysis is the rate-limiting step in soil organic matter decomposition, and <i>V</i><sub><em>max</em></sub> and <i>K</i><sub><em>m</em></sub> are enzyme kinetic parameters reflecting enzyme catalytic capacity. However, it is still far from clear how these enzymatic kinetic parameters respond to altered precipitation and subsequently influence soil microbial respiration (<i>R</i><sub><em>h</em></sub>). Here, we examined the <i>V</i><sub><em>max</em></sub> and <i>K</i><sub><em>m</em></sub> of seven soil hydrolytic enzymes and polyphenol oxidase (PPO), <i>R</i><sub><em>h</em></sub>, and microbial biomass carbon (MBC) under altered precipitation (-30%, ambient, and +30%) across three steppes.
